Use framing square and … WebUse the handle of a putty knife to gently knock down any roughness around the hole. Step 2: De-gloss the Area Using 220-grit sandpaper, lightly de-gloss a small area around the hole. This helps the filler adhere properly. Step 3: Clean the Surface After de-glossing, wipe the surface clean and make sure it’s free of any dust or foreign material.
WebUsing a putty knife and apply the filler to the hole. Scrape away any excess filler. Smooth the repair with the paper knife and let it dry. The window team will only remove necessary pieces and do so without … how many seasons are in portlandiaWeb10 mrt. 2024 · Replacing a vinyl siding panel is easy if you do it with a zip tool. This inexpensive tool easily unlocks the panel from the one above it, allowing you to remove the fasteners and take it down.
